Why Grid-Connected Inverter Control Matters
Did you know that 68% of solar power systems globally now use three-phase grid-connected inverters? These devices act as translators between renewable energy sources and utility grids, converting DC power to AC while maintaining grid stability. Let's break down the key control strategies making this possible.
Core Control Techniques
- Voltage Source Control (VSC): Maintains stable voltage parameters during grid disturbances
- Current Control Mode: Prioritizes precise current regulation for sensitive equipment
- MPPT Integration: Maximizes energy harvest from solar/wind sources

Synchronization Challenges Solved
Imagine trying to dance perfectly in sync with a partner you can't see – that's what grid synchronization feels like for inverters. Modern solutions use:
- Phase-Locked Loop (PLL) systems with < 0.5° phase error
- Adaptive filtering for noisy grid conditions
- Predictive current control responding in <50μs

Future-Proofing Your System
With grid codes becoming 42% stricter since 2020, forward-looking designs now incorporate:
- Reactive power compensation capabilities
- Advanced fault ride-through mechanisms
- AI-assisted predictive maintenance features
